Output baf60ef50340fa73a9e43f6ddcf440b4e73a8fd54a68cd4fb8c67513aa021bf3:0

value
45729
script pubkey
OP_0 OP_PUSHBYTES_20 8ad40665541bde50fdd88c0b0305fbbe46f21745
address
bc1q3t2qve25r009plwc3s9sxp0mher0y9692ufmy6
transaction
baf60ef50340fa73a9e43f6ddcf440b4e73a8fd54a68cd4fb8c67513aa021bf3
confirmations
172043
spent
true